Technical vaseline is a universal lubricant with a wide range of applications. This product, based on selected mineral oils and waxes, is characterized by excellent thermal stability and resistance to oxidation. Technical vaseline is waterproof, which guarantees its effectiveness even in difficult conditions. It has the consistency of thick, uniform fat with a color ranging from white to light yellow. The use of technical petroleum jelly is diverse and includes lubrication of mechanisms, protection and maintenance of mechanical elements in the automotive industry, protection against corrosion of metal elements in industry and lubrication of hinges, slides, mechanisms and other moving elements in the home.
